Principles for maintaining global style invariants through centralized tokens and rules
Ensuring a unified visual rhythm across diverse interfaces requires disciplined governance of spacing, typography, and scale via centralized tokens, scalable guidelines, and consistent application across platforms and teams.
Published August 09, 2025
Facebook X Reddit Pinterest Email
The challenge of maintaining a cohesive visual system grows as projects scale, teams expand, and platforms diversify. Centralized tokens act as the single source of truth for typographic scale, spacing steps, color families, and component behaviors. Design decisions trickle down through a predictable chain, so new screens inherit a familiar cadence without ad hoc tweaks. Teams benefit from reduced cognitive load because words like “base line” or “grid unit” acquire consistent meanings. When tokens are well designed, they become a lingua franca that unites designers and developers, enabling faster iteration while preserving accessibility and readability as the product evolves over time.
A robust token strategy begins with a principled scale, harmonizing font sizes, line heights, and letter spacing. Rather than floating values, you establish named steps that map to predictable pixel or rem values, scaled by a defined ratio. Spacing tokens mirror the rhythm of type, creating vertical metrics that feel intentional rather than accidental. By isolating responsive behavior behind token-driven rules, you avoid layout drift when viewports change or content length varies. The result is a system that feels stable to users and maintainable for engineers, where updates require editing token definitions rather than hunting through scattered CSS and style guides.
Governance and tooling align teams around shared scale decisions
Centralized tokens empower teams to enforce global invariants without micromanaging individual components. They provide a shared vocabulary for sizes, spacings, and line heights that remains stable across feature work, prototypes, and production releases. When designers propose a new component, the token layer determines whether its typography aligns with the existing scale, preventing surprises during integration. Developers gain confidence because they rely on a deterministic baseline rather than ad hoc measurements. This reduces cross-team conflicts and ensures the product’s visual language is recognizable to users, even as content and requirements shift over months and years.
ADVERTISEMENT
ADVERTISEMENT
Implementing tokens demands disciplined governance and clear ownership. A token repository should include versioning, deprecation notices, and migration paths to minimize breaking changes. Documentation must explain the rationale behind each scale and spacing decision, linking it to real-world usage patterns like readability, touch targets, and visual hierarchy. Automated tests can verify that components render within permissible token ranges, while visual regression checks catch drift introduced by updates. When tokens are treated as code, not hints, the system becomes auditable, traceable, and resilient to the noise that often accompanies rapid product development.
Tokens support accessibility, theming, and cross-platform consistency
The first step in governance is to codify a design system with explicit rules for typography, rhythm, and grid behavior. This includes a defined baseline grid, consistent line-height rules, and a method for responsive typography that preserves readability at all sizes. Tools that map visual tokens to CSS variables or framework-specific constructs help engineers implement designs with precision. Even small projects gain cohesion when token-driven policies are in place, shortening onboarding time for new contributors and reducing the likelihood of divergent UI patterns. The governance model should reward thoughtful iteration while guarding against unnecessary fragmentation caused by rapid, untracked changes.
ADVERTISEMENT
ADVERTISEMENT
The practical benefits extend beyond aesthetics to accessibility and performance. Centralized tokens simplify accessibility audits by ensuring contrast ratios, scalable text, and touch targets stay within certified ranges. Developers can adjust global accessibility settings by updating a single token collection, rather than hunting through dozens of components. Performance benefits emerge as well because design decisions no longer require repeated recalculations or bespoke CSS. A token-centric approach also facilitates theming, enabling light and dark modes or brand-specific palettes without compromising the core rhythm and spacing that users rely on.
Spacing discipline, rhythm, and scalable typography sustain trust
Cross-platform consistency hinges on how tokens translate into components across web, mobile, and embedded environments. A well-abstracted token model defines not only type scales but also responsive behavior rules that survive platform-specific quirks. Designers should test tokens against real content, ensuring that line lengths, word wrapping, and typographic hierarchy communicate clearly in different languages and densities. The engineering side translates these token specifications into robust components with predictable rendering, avoiding platform drift. When tokens are honored by every layer—from CSS to compiled UI kits—the interface feels cohesive, regardless of the channel or device used.
Beyond typography, tokens must govern spacing relationships, alignment systems, and rhythm across the UI. The concept of a single “grid unit” becomes a cognitive anchor for both creators and viewers. By locking margins, paddings, and gaps to discrete steps, layouts become scalable yet consistent, which reduces the risk of awkward alignment when components are rearranged. The discipline also helps with content-aware adjustments, ensuring that expansion or contraction of elements preserves the overall cadence. Over time, this consistency strengthens trust and lowers the mental effort users expend to navigate complex interfaces.
ADVERTISEMENT
ADVERTISEMENT
A living contract between design and code sustains coherence
The long-term health of a product rests on how well it scales, not merely how it looks at launch. A token-based approach means you can extend the system to new components without rethinking the entire visual language. When teams add a button variant or a navigation item, the tokens guide sizing, spacing, and typographic emphasis, producing a coherent outcome. This reduces variance across pages and features, making the product feel reliable. The predictability cultivated by tokens translates into faster fixes, quicker feature delivery, and fewer visual regressions during iterations.
Teams should also consider migration paths as part of token evolution. Deprecating outdated values without breaking changes requires careful phasing, documentation, and iteration windows. A clear plan helps maintainers communicate intent and reduces resistance from stakeholders who might rely on older patterns. The most successful migrations occur when token changes are incremental, reversible when possible, and accompanied by tooling that flags inconsistencies. By treating tokens as a living contract between design and code, organizations preserve continuity while remaining adaptable to new needs and technologies.
In practice, successful organizations establish a feedback loop that continuously refines tokens based on real-world usage. Designers observe how typography scales interact with content density, while developers report performance and accessibility outcomes. Regular reviews of token usage help identify drift, propose adjustments, and celebrate consistency wins. The loop is aided by automated checks and review processes that prevent speculative changes from fragmenting the system. Over time, the tokens themselves become a documentary of decisions, illustrating why certain scales and spacings exist and how they support legibility, navigation, and visual hierarchy.
The end goal is a resilient, scalable web frontend that feels intentional in every interaction. Centralized tokens and rules deliver that intent by coordinating typography, rhythm, and spacing into a shared discipline. Teams that invest in governance, tooling, and ongoing stewardship reduce complexity, improve accessibility, and accelerate delivery without sacrificing quality. When users encounter consistent patterns across pages and devices, trust grows, and the product earns a reputation for clarity and professionalism. Centralized style invariants are not a constraint but a strategic asset that underpins durable, delightful user experiences.
Related Articles
Web frontend
Crafting robust focus management in dynamic interfaces demands a clear philosophy, disciplined patterns, and accessible primitives that gracefully handle transitions, modals, and route changes without trapping users or breaking flow.
-
July 15, 2025
Web frontend
This evergreen guide reveals practical strategies for building modular accessibility utilities, enabling developers to consistently apply ARIA attributes, roles, and interactive behavior across diverse UI components with confidence and speed.
-
July 31, 2025
Web frontend
A practical exploration of integrating component performance profiling into development workflows, detailing strategies to reveal bottlenecks, quantify improvements, and align profiling with continuous delivery goals across modern frontend systems.
-
August 04, 2025
Web frontend
This guide presents enduring strategies for building CSS systems that gracefully handle themes, locales, and component variations, while minimizing duplication, promoting reuse, and preserving maintainability across evolving front-end projects.
-
July 30, 2025
Web frontend
A practical, evergreen guide to building robust, secure file uploads through rigorous client side validation, resilient chunking strategies, and resumable transfer capabilities that adapt to unreliable networks while preserving user experience and data integrity.
-
July 24, 2025
Web frontend
A practical guide to crafting robust component theming APIs that enable dynamic overrides, layered inheritance, and precise scope controls while avoiding cross-cutting conflicts across a UI system.
-
August 09, 2025
Web frontend
In low bandwidth environments, delivering a fast, usable initial render hinges on prioritizing critical content, deferring non essential assets, and aggressively compressing payloads, while maintaining accessibility, responsiveness, and search visibility across devices and networks.
-
August 12, 2025
Web frontend
Designing robust CSS token mappings for multi-theme ecosystems requires disciplined governance, scalable naming, platform-aware fallbacks, and a clear strategy for cross-project reuse that reduces drift and speeds delivery.
-
July 25, 2025
Web frontend
Effective client side input validation requires clear rules, seamless server cooperation, and a shared model that minimizes redundant checks while preserving performance and accessibility for users across devices and networks.
-
August 08, 2025
Web frontend
Privacy-preserving analytics balance user consent with actionable insights by combining transparent data practices, flexible consent models, on-device processing, and principled aggregation techniques, enabling organizations to extract value without compromising individual privacy.
-
August 07, 2025
Web frontend
This evergreen guide explores building highly composable select controls with accessibility, virtualization, and robust keyboard filtering, focusing on scalable data handling and a resilient API that developers can reuse across projects.
-
August 07, 2025
Web frontend
Designing resilient web layouts requires adaptable grids, responsive components, and thoughtful strategies for dynamic content and user customization, ensuring stability, accessibility, and a pleasing visual rhythm across devices and contexts.
-
July 29, 2025
Web frontend
Designing live updating lists that feel instantaneous requires careful orchestration of rendering, accessibility semantics, and scroll preservation, ensuring updates occur without jarring layout shifts or hidden content, and with intuitive focus management for keyboard users.
-
August 03, 2025
Web frontend
Designing robust component APIs requires disciplined prop structures and thoughtful defaults; this guide outlines practical strategies for clarity, maintainability, and scalable configuration without overloading components with options.
-
July 23, 2025
Web frontend
This evergreen guide explains building accessible rich text editors that respect native semantics, deliver robust keyboard navigation, and ensure screen reader compatibility across modern browsers and assistive technologies.
-
July 22, 2025
Web frontend
A practical guide to designing localization pipelines that are predictable, testable, and scalable, enabling context-aware translations, accurate plural forms, and culturally aware formatting across diverse global audiences.
-
August 08, 2025
Web frontend
Build web experiences that imitate native performance and design cues, yet honor platform constraints, ensuring reliability, accessibility, offline resilience, and forward compatibility across diverse devices and browser environments.
-
July 31, 2025
Web frontend
Designing maintainable Storybook collections requires modeling real world usage, establishing guardrails for consumers, and aligning with development workflows to sustain clarity, accessibility, and scalable growth over time.
-
July 17, 2025
Web frontend
A practical, architecture‑oriented guide to orchestrating hydration reconciliation so rendering remains single source of truth, eliminating double renders, mismatched content, and jank across server and client execution paths.
-
August 07, 2025
Web frontend
A practical guide for frontend teams to organize, scale, and sustain a unified styling approach, enabling flexible component variants, clean breakpoints, and consistent design systems across complex applications.
-
July 30, 2025